I'm not sure what you mean.
Textures that do not come with the HD Morphs = non HD Textures. So if the texture set isn't made of a HD Morph then it will not follow the HD Morphs etc. That is what I have heard and wanted to see what others say that have these Base textures and HD morphs.
ISTR there was a bug at one point with exported objects having slightly different UV maps at different SubD levels, which has been fixed. I don't recall anything about HD morphs affecting UVs.
I'm confused by what you mean by "Follow the morph"
Are you asking "Do the textures have the highlights/details represented by the HD morphs painted on them?" The ridges on the dragon belly in my first picture are HD morphs, but don't appear on the texture. And I thought that was one of the points for HD anyway, that those sort of details don't need to be painted on any more.
I would guess HD features like belly ridges would transfer across nicely but other details might not. Take http://www.daz3d.com/new-releases/spectral-dragon-hd-for-daz-dragon-3 for example, some of those HD features aren't present in the Base and might stretch a base made texture set. I don't know that is why I am asking these questions so I can make informed purchases as I have to be very selective in what I buy. I do like http://www.daz3d.com/new-releases/spectral-dragon-hd-for-daz-dragon-3 but if I am going to have problems when using http://www.daz3d.com/daz-dragon-3-textures on that HD shape then I may leave it.
If textures are made to any specific character shape, there will be stretching on other shapes. That is not a result of HD, just how meshes work.
The more extreme the shape change, the more extreme the distortion.
Some textures do follow the extra details in the HD morphs, I know mine do, so that it can add more visual detail to the HD morphed scales on my characters. But the HD details themselves will cause less stretching distortion than the actual morph that adjusts the shape.
Yeah it makes sense on extreme morphs granted. So as it stands I should be ok if the morphs or HD details aren't too extreme. I can live and deal with a little manipulation if required.
